Adventure Tips

Bring Reef-Safe Sunscreen

Protect your skin and the ocean’s delicate coral reefs by using reef-safe sunscreen during your sailing trip.

Pack Light, Secure Belongings

Keep your essentials in a waterproof bag and dress in lightweight, quick-drying clothes for comfort on deck.

Stay Hydrated

The Florida sun can be intense—drink plenty of water to stay refreshed throughout your adventure.

Ask About Snorkeling Gear

Check with your captain if snorkeling equipment is provided or if you should bring your own for exploring reefs.

History

Key West has a rich maritime history as a former naval base and hub for pirates, shipwreck salvagers, and traders.

Conservation

Efforts in the Florida Keys focus on protecting coral reefs and marine habitats through sustainable boating and fishing practices.
